Online Programming Learning Platform Progate Surpasses 400K Users

Bangalore, India, July 3, 2018 – Progate, Japan’s biggest online platform for students to learn modern programming skills, announced that it has surpassed 400K users worldwide.

That is double the figure of October 2017, when the company first expanded their business to the global market launching its web service “Progate” in English.

Masa Kato CEO of Progate: “400K users is a great accomplishment and we are proud of Progate’s huge growth. We have 50K users in India, and it is the largest market following our home market. We hope to keep expanding further this year, particularly in India where people are active in STEM education from early ages and online learning is increasingly in demand.  

India is the first market where Progate has formed a local team. With an aim to upskill current workforces and prepare students for developer-focused careers, Progate has been engaging with educational institutions including the Indian Institute of Technology and other top tier engineering colleges in the country through the Progate Ambassador Community program. The program aims at making students job ready by equipping them with modern tools to learn and execute programming. The company currently offers special pricing for students in India. A certificate of completion is also being exclusively offered to users of the Progate web service in India.

About Progate:

Bringing creativity to everyone, everywhere.

Progate started when its founders were inspired to empower others through programming in July 2014. Progate’s vision is to bring creativity to everyone, everywhere by providing the best learning environment in which beginners can learn programming while having fun.

Masa Kato co-founded Progate in 2014 and was selected by Forbes ASIA as one of the 30 entrepreneurs under 30 in March, 2018. Progate is now the largest online programming learning services in Japan with over 400,000 individual users and is used for self-study, in the classroom, and corporate in-house training.
